Albanian Alps attract thousands of domestic and international visitors as mountain tourism continues to grow during the summer season.
In early July, visitors explore the National Park of the Albanian Alps, drawn by its spectacular landscapes, hiking routes, and unique natural attractions.
Moreover, foreign tourists choose the region for outdoor adventures, discovering crystal-clear rivers, deep valleys, mountain passes, and rich biodiversity.
The area offers breathtaking destinations such as the Shala, Valbona, Curraj, and Cemi rivers, as well as mountain lakes that provide visitors with both tranquility and adventure.
Furthermore, peaks including Radohima, Maja e Hekurave, Maja e Arapit, and Maja e Shkëlzenit attract hiking enthusiasts with their impressive views and challenging trails.
As a result, the Albanian Alps continue to strengthen their position as one of Albania’s most attractive destinations for nature tourism and adventure experiences.
